Aion's server merger will take place later this week, but issues with certain names will be handled in two ways. Last week, NCsoft announced plans to handle character names using server extensions and providing players with a redeemable name ticket that can be used on a first come, first served basis. However, the second naming issue comes into play with Legions and before the merge some Legions may find that their names have been changed with an added server abbreviation to avoid a naming conflict. If this happens to your Legion, the Legion’s Brigade General will receive a free Legion Name Change Ticket much like the character name change tickets that can be used once the merger is complete.

Before the merge, we will manually identify Legions that may run into a naming conflict with another Legion during the server merge. After identifying all Legions in conflict, our customer service team will be applying a set of criteria to determine which Legions will maintain their names without any change and which Legions will have an identifying server abbreviation appended to them. These name changes will be taking place before the merge.

Additional details can be found in the Server Merger FAQ.
